There is probably more than what is being said here otherwise clients for reddit or 4chan would have been removed a long time ago.

Big 4chan apps like Clover got banned off the play store long ago. The reason given was nsfw content, but in the app you had to manually add nsfw boards, much like Reddit's nsfw communities. Picking and choosing which social media platforms to ban has already been a thing.
